Dr. Dat Do has been dedicated to serving the South Bay Community for 6 years. In addition to his optometric degree from the Illinois College of Optomery, he did an additional fellowship year in ocular pathology and refractive surgery at the Omni Eye Services. His broad optometric experience includes his current position as a Clinical Adjunct Professor at Southern California College of Optometry. Prior to joining the South Bay Optometric Society, Dr. Do was the Clinical Director at the TLC Laser Eye Center (formerly Pacific Laser Eye Center) and a Clinical Instructor at Omni Eye Services. He is a member of the American Academy of Optometry AAO and regularly contributes to various AAO-sponsored eye care journals and presentations and lectured in the area of co-management of refractive surgery, glaucoma and dry eye.

Aside from regular optometric duties, Dr. Do has been involved in volunteering eye care in Peru and Vietnam. In his spare time, he enjoys waterskiing, snowboarding, rock climbing and training for the marathons. Currently he is involved in raising and training Damita, an assistance dog, for Canine Companion for Independence.
